    City-Level Homogeneous Blocks Identification for IP Geolocation

    Fuxiang Yuan, Fenlin Liu, Chong Liu, Xiangyang Luo*

    Intelligent Automation & Soft Computing, Vol.26, No.6, pp. 1403-1417, 2020, DOI:10.32604/iasc.2020.011902

    Abstract IPs in homogeneous blocks are tightly connected and close to each other in topology and geography, which can help geolocate sensitive target IPs and maintain network security. Therefore, this manuscript proposes a city-level homogeneous blocks identification algorithm for IP geolocation. Firstly, IPs with consistent geographic location information in multiple databases and some landmarks in a specific area are obtained as targets; the /31 containing each target is used as a candidate block; vantage points are deployed to probe IPs in the candidate blocks to obtain delays and paths, and alias resolution is performed.
